How does alcohol affect your weight?

Alcohol can cause weight gain in four ways: it stops your body from burning fat, it’s high in kilojoules, it can make you feel hungry , and it can lead to poor food choices.

How much does alcohol contribute to weight gain?

Without taking food into account, drinking 5 beers (regular, not light) two nights a week for 40 weeks out of a year adds up to more than 60,000 calories, which could lead to at least a 10-15 pound weight gain if a person doesn’t compensate for the same amount of calories by eating less or being more physically active.

Does alcohol make your face fat?

Excessive alcohol intake can cause dehydration, which can prompt the body to retain water. In some cases, this may lead to water retention in the face, which can make the face appear bloated and puffy. Alcohol may also contribute to weight gain.

How alcohol affects your looks?

Alcohol causes your body and skin to lose fluid (dehydrate). Dry skin wrinkles more quickly and can look dull and grey. Alcohol’s diuretic (water-loss) effect also causes you to lose vitamins and nutrients. For example, vitamin A.

Does alcohol age your face?

Alcohol accelerates skin aging, says Colin Milner, CEO of the International Council on Active Aging. Wrinkles, puffiness, dryness, red cheeks and purple capillaries – heavy drinking can add years to your face. Alcohol dehydrates the entire body, and that includes your skin.
